What would happen if your indoor blower control fan relay went out on a heat pump? ?

It could cause damage to compressor motor, some units have flow switches on them to prevent this from happening but with all mfg. trying to make cheaper units this is a feature not used much in home units. If compressor was running without the indoor coil removing the heat this is transferred back to compressor causing the winding thermostat to open and shut off compressor. But if continued over a long period of time the thermostat could go bad...The indoor blower relay should not cause the indoor fan motor to go bad unless it is constantly opening and closing causing a high current draw in the motor...
